In higher vocational English teaching, the project-based teaching model is beneficial for reinforcing students' English skills through practical application and better meeting the diverse needs of career development. However, issues such as low student engagement, unreasonable project design, and an incomplete evaluation system persist in practice. To address these challenges, it is suggested to enhance student initiative, optimize project design, and improve the evaluation system to better promote the innovation of the project-based teaching model in higher vocational English. This, in turn, can facilitate the comprehensive development of students' language abilities.
